FL S1414
Resolution
AI Summary
-
Recognizes Bay County on the occasion of its centennial celebration, marking 100 years since its establishment on July 1, 1913.
-
Acknowledges Bay County's geographic and economic features, including 27 miles of beaches, 1,033 square miles of total area, and attraction of 8 million annual visitors.
-
Notes Bay County's significant population growth from 11,407 residents in 1920 to approximately 170,000 in 2010.
-
Honors the residents, community leaders, and elected officials of Bay County for their contributions to the state's economic well-being, history, and cultural diversity.
-
Directs presentation of a copy of the resolution to the chairman of the Bay County Board of County Commissioners.
